(RELIGION) Foulis, Henry (ed.). THE HISTORY OF ROMISH TREASONS & USURPATIONS:
Together with a Particular Account of Many Gross Corruptions and Impostures
in the Church of Rome, Highly Dishonourable and Injurious to Christian
Religion. To Which Is Prefixt a Large Preface to the Romanists. Carefully Collected
Out of a Great Number of Their Own Approved Authors. London: Printed by J. C.
for Tho. Dring. 1671. First edition. Folio. (52),726pp. With the half-title.
Very nicely rebound in period style, full ruled calf with red morocco spine
label. Small burn hole in a leaf of the table of contents affecting a few letters.
$1,250.00 (trade discount allowed)
Wing F1640.
